// Returns the value (0 .. 15) of a hexadecimal character c.
// If c is not a legal hexadecimal character, returns a value < 0.
inline int HexValue(uc32 c) {
c -= '0';
if (static_cast<unsigned>(c) <= 9) return c;
c = (c | 0x20) - ('a' - '0'); // detect 0x11..0x16 and 0x31..0x36.
if (static_cast<unsigned>(c) <= 5) return c + 10;
return -1;
}
// ---------------------------------------------------------------------
// Buffered stream of UTF-16 code units, using an internal UTF-16 buffer.
// A code unit is a 16 bit value representing either a 16 bit code point
// or one part of a surrogate pair that make a single 21 bit code point.
class Utf16CharacterStream {
public:
Utf16CharacterStream() : pos_(0) { }
virtual ~Utf16CharacterStream() { }
// Returns and advances past the next UTF-16 code unit in the input
// stream. If there are no more code units, it returns a negative
// value.
inline uc32 Advance() {
if (buffer_cursor_ < buffer_end_ || ReadBlock()) {
pos_++;
return static_cast<uc32>(*(buffer_cursor_++));
}
// Note: currently the following increment is necessary to avoid a
// parser problem! The scanner treats the final kEndOfInput as
// a code unit with a position, and does math relative to that
// position.
pos_++;
return kEndOfInput;
}
// Return the current position in the code unit stream.
// Starts at zero.
inline size_t pos() const { return pos_; }
// Skips forward past the next code_unit_count UTF-16 code units
// in the input, or until the end of input if that comes sooner.
// Returns the number of code units actually skipped. If less
// than code_unit_count,
inline size_t SeekForward(size_t code_unit_count) {
size_t buffered_chars = buffer_end_ - buffer_cursor_;
if (code_unit_count <= buffered_chars) {
buffer_cursor_ += code_unit_count;
pos_ += code_unit_count;
return code_unit_count;
}
return SlowSeekForward(code_unit_count);
}
// Pushes back the most recently read UTF-16 code unit (or negative
// value if at end of input), i.e., the value returned by the most recent
// call to Advance.
// Must not be used right after calling SeekForward.
virtual void PushBack(int32_t code_unit) = 0;
virtual bool SetBookmark();
virtual void ResetToBookmark();
protected:
static const uc32 kEndOfInput = -1;
// Ensures that the buffer_cursor_ points to the code_unit at
// position pos_ of the input, if possible. If the position
// is at or after the end of the input, return false. If there
// are more code_units available, return true.
virtual bool ReadBlock() = 0;
virtual size_t SlowSeekForward(size_t code_unit_count) = 0;
const uint16_t* buffer_cursor_;
const uint16_t* buffer_end_;
size_t pos_;
};

// ----------------------------------------------------------------------------
// LiteralBuffer - Collector of chars of literals.
class LiteralBuffer {
public:
LiteralBuffer() : is_one_byte_(true), position_(0), backing_store_() { }
~LiteralBuffer() { backing_store_.Dispose(); }
INLINE(void AddChar(uint32_t code_unit)) {
if (position_ >= backing_store_.length()) ExpandBuffer();
if (is_one_byte_) {
if (code_unit <= unibrow::Latin1::kMaxChar) {
backing_store_[position_] = static_cast<byte>(code_unit);
position_ += kOneByteSize;
return;
}
ConvertToTwoByte();
}
if (code_unit <= unibrow::Utf16::kMaxNonSurrogateCharCode) {
*reinterpret_cast<uint16_t*>(&backing_store_[position_]) = code_unit;
position_ += kUC16Size;
} else {
*reinterpret_cast<uint16_t*>(&backing_store_[position_]) =
unibrow::Utf16::LeadSurrogate(code_unit);
position_ += kUC16Size;
if (position_ >= backing_store_.length()) ExpandBuffer();
*reinterpret_cast<uint16_t*>(&backing_store_[position_]) =
unibrow::Utf16::TrailSurrogate(code_unit);
position_ += kUC16Size;
}
}
bool is_one_byte() const { return is_one_byte_; }
bool is_contextual_keyword(Vector<const char> keyword) const {
return is_one_byte() && keyword.length() == position_ &&
(memcmp(keyword.start(), backing_store_.start(), position_) == 0);
}
Vector<const uint16_t> two_byte_literal() const {
DCHECK(!is_one_byte_);
DCHECK((position_ & 0x1) == 0);
return Vector<const uint16_t>(
reinterpret_cast<const uint16_t*>(backing_store_.start()),
position_ >> 1);
}
Vector<const uint8_t> one_byte_literal() const {
DCHECK(is_one_byte_);
return Vector<const uint8_t>(
reinterpret_cast<const uint8_t*>(backing_store_.start()),
position_);
}
int length() const {
return is_one_byte_ ? position_ : (position_ >> 1);
}
void ReduceLength(int delta) {
position_ -= delta * (is_one_byte_ ? kOneByteSize : kUC16Size);
}
void Reset() {
position_ = 0;
is_one_byte_ = true;
}
Handle<String> Internalize(Isolate* isolate) const;
void CopyFrom(const LiteralBuffer* other) {
if (other == nullptr) {
Reset();
} else {
is_one_byte_ = other->is_one_byte_;
position_ = other->position_;
backing_store_.Dispose();
backing_store_ = other->backing_store_.Clone();
}
}
private:
static const int kInitialCapacity = 16;
static const int kGrowthFactory = 4;
static const int kMinConversionSlack = 256;
static const int kMaxGrowth = 1 * MB;
inline int NewCapacity(int min_capacity) {
int capacity = Max(min_capacity, backing_store_.length());
int new_capacity = Min(capacity * kGrowthFactory, capacity + kMaxGrowth);
return new_capacity;
}
void ExpandBuffer() {
Vector<byte> new_store = Vector<byte>::New(NewCapacity(kInitialCapacity));
MemCopy(new_store.start(), backing_store_.start(), position_);
backing_store_.Dispose();
backing_store_ = new_store;
}
void ConvertToTwoByte() {
DCHECK(is_one_byte_);
Vector<byte> new_store;
int new_content_size = position_ * kUC16Size;
if (new_content_size >= backing_store_.length()) {
// Ensure room for all currently read code units as UC16 as well
// as the code unit about to be stored.
new_store = Vector<byte>::New(NewCapacity(new_content_size));
} else {
new_store = backing_store_;
}
uint8_t* src = backing_store_.start();
uint16_t* dst = reinterpret_cast<uint16_t*>(new_store.start());
for (int i = position_ - 1; i >= 0; i--) {
dst[i] = src[i];
}
if (new_store.start() != backing_store_.start()) {
backing_store_.Dispose();
backing_store_ = new_store;
}
position_ = new_content_size;
is_one_byte_ = false;
}
bool is_one_byte_;
int position_;
Vector<byte> backing_store_;
DISALLOW_COPY_AND_ASSIGN(LiteralBuffer);
};
